C sharp - Relaciones de clases

   
Vista:

Relaciones de clases

Publicado por jorge gomez (1 intervención) el 24/08/2008 07:42:55
Hola amigos de la comunidad, me dirijo a ustedes buscando ayuda, estoy en el trabajando en un proyecto y necesito realizar una relacion entre clases, las que son persona, region y comuna. Lo cual estoy haciendo de la siguiente manera.

La clase region posee un campo que es una lista de comunas pero no se como asociar la comuna con la persona, no se si la clase persona debe tener un campo del tipo comuna o del tipo region o si la clase comuna debe tener un campo del tipo region o no se.

Espero me puedan guiar y ayudar a resolver de la mejor manera mi problematica.

Muchas gracias
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Relaciones de clases

Publicado por YamilBracho (1111 intervenciones) el 05/09/2008 19:30:12
No entiendo muy bien el problema pero basicamente seria preguntarte los siguientes puntos:

1) Una persona solo pertenece a una comuna
2) Una comuna puede tener una o mas personas asociadas
3) Una persona puede tener varias comunas asociadas
4) Una persona puede estar en varias comunas

Dependiendo de lo que respondas vas a tener una relacion una a una (1), una relacion una a muchas (2) y (3) y una relacion muchas a muchas (4)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ar